Alpha Channel appears black when flattened


Recommended Posts

I am having trouble figuring out how to work with the Alpha Channel in Affinity Designer (v1.7.1). When I export a graphic from Designer as an image file and then open that file in an program like GraphicConverter and flatten it, the background is black. In all other drawing programs I've used over the years, this same process results in a white background.

I have looked through forum posts and web searches for tips on how to work with Designer's alpha channel, but I have not been able to figure this out.

Is there a setting in Designer that can make the alpha channel always appear white instead of black? If not, how do I change the alpha channel from black to white for each file I create?
